Im designing a domestic water system for a 1400 population, i want to know how to obtain the size of the maindistribution line, trasmission line, and pipe used inside the house??

I want to obtain this sizes economically.. we have a limited budget...tnx a lot.

Here is the information that you are looking for.

For a normal single family residence, I recommend a 3/4-Inch water supply. If you have a very wealthy residence with multiple bathrooms, etc. you should upsize to at least to 1-Inch service.

Water mains will probably be 50 mm with 150 mm transmission mains.

one more thing the AWWA is refering for a 1500mm main distribution. is inner, nominal , or outer diameter?
 
Pipe diameter usually refers to the nominal inside diameter.
